Output 315a6403e3cef5a3a36fa068a2849559f87c98065a099c3e04372114d187443e:94

value
1962361
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a2fd56b290e1df4852b390a6c38e3bf5b989682 OP_EQUALVERIFY OP_CHECKSIG
address
LXpcpE7wT6dXNgtX57emhxZbASHEyeqDhE
transaction
315a6403e3cef5a3a36fa068a2849559f87c98065a099c3e04372114d187443e
spent
true